What is MCP Server for SQL Server using node-mssql?

The MCP Server for SQL Server utilizing node-mssql enables developers and system administrators to integrate SQL Server management into automated systems seamlessly. It supports executing SQL queries, managing database connections, and handling database operations remotely. Built with TypeScript, it offers a robust and flexible way to embed SQL Server interactions into various automation platforms, reducing manual intervention, improving efficiency, and supporting scalable database operations across different environments.

How to use the MCP Server for SQL Server using node-mssql?

  • Step 1: Install the MCP and set up your project environment.
  • Step 2: Configure your `mcp.json` or relevant config file with your SQL Server credentials and connection details.
  • Step 3: Integrate the MCP server into your automation platform or scripts by referencing the configuration.
  • Step 4: Use the specified commands to connect and execute SQL queries remotely.
  • Step 5: Monitor logs and outputs to verify successful connection and data operations.
